For Monday, January 26, 2026, the Texas Lottery Daily lineup featured Cash Five with winning numbers 2-8-9-18-25 and Texas Two Step with 1-4-12-17 plus Bonus Ball 34. Texas Two Step dangled a $1.13 million jackpot, while Cash Five delivered its usual fixed top prize structure. Players should verify on the official Texas Lottery site whether the Texas Two Step jackpot was hit or will roll to the next draw.
